    Trump signed a proclamation which additionally restricts the journey of individuals from a further seven international locations.

    United States President Donald Trump has signed an govt order imposing a full journey ban on folks from 12 international locations and limiting the residents of seven different international locations, The Related Press information company stories.

    The banned international locations embody Afghanistan, Chad, Congo, Equatorial Guinea, Eritrea, Haiti, Iran, Libya, Myanmar, Somalia, Sudan and Yemen.

    Along with the ban, which takes impact on Monday, there will probably be heightened restrictions on folks from Burundi, Cuba, Laos, Sierra Leone, Togo, Turkmenistan and Venezuela.

    “I need to act to guard the nationwide safety and nationwide curiosity of america and its folks,” Trump stated in his order.

    In a video message launched by the White Home, Trump stated the latest assault on a pro-Israel rally in Boulder, Colorado had “underscored the intense risks posed to our nation by the entry of overseas nationals who are usually not correctly vetted”.

    The president stated there have been “thousands and thousands and thousands and thousands of those illegals who shouldn’t be in our nation”.

    “We is not going to let what occurred in Europe occur to America,” he stated, including, “very merely, we can’t have open migration from any nation the place we can’t safely and reliably vet and display those that search to enter america”.

    “We is not going to permit folks to enter our nation who want to do us hurt.”

    Throughout his first time period in 2017, Trump issued an govt order banning journey to the US by residents of seven predominantly Muslim international locations: Iran, Iraq, Libya, Somalia, Sudan, Syria and Yemen.

    Individuals from the named international locations had been both barred from getting on their flights to the US or detained at US airports after they landed. These affected included vacationers, folks visiting family and friends, college students and college members at US establishments, and businesspeople.

    The order, sometimes called the “Muslim ban” or the “journey ban”, was reworked amid authorized challenges till a model was upheld by the Supreme Court docket in 2018, which banned classes of travellers and immigrants from Iran, Somalia, Yemen, Syria and Libya, plus North Korean and a few Venezuelan authorities officers and their households.

    Trump defended his preliminary journey ban on nationwide safety grounds, arguing that it was geared toward defending the US and claiming that it was not anti-Muslim. Nonetheless, Trump had referred to as for a journey ban on Muslims throughout his first marketing campaign for the White Home.
